使用Anaconda或Canopy安装Python模块

时间:2015-01-27 16:34:19

标签: python anaconda canopy spyder libtiff

我已经玩了一点Python,但从来没有必须安装我自己的软件包。我目前正在尝试编写一个读入&#t; tiff'文件,所以我试图安装' libtiff'包裹和我有一场噩梦!

首先,我使用的是Anaconda发行版和短语“conda install libtiff'哪会告诉我安装成功。然而,我无法在Spyder IDE或ipython控制台中找到libtiff。

过去使用了Canopy,我卸载了Anaconda,并使用“pip install libtiff'”给了Canopy另一个镜头,但是我收到错误,说它失败了,错误代码为1,我不知道这是什么。

我必须错过一些相当重要的东西,但安装这个模块几乎是不可能的!

2 个答案:

答案 0 :(得分:2)

Conda的libtiff包是C库,而不是Python库。最简单的方法是使用conda来安装依赖项(如libtiffnumpy),然后使用pip安装libtiff({{1} })。

答案 1 :(得分:2)

在spyder中的 IPython 控制台上使用!,您可以使用pip。因此,在示例中,您可以执行以下操作:

In [1]: !pip install libtiff

请注意,在~2.3.3之前的Spyder版本的Python控制台上也可以使用(虽然可能不可靠)。